A contract is a dollar bill that might not exist
It pays $1 if the thing happens. It pays $0 if it does not. That is the whole product.
So if Chalk to win is trading at 62 cents, you are paying 62 cents for a shot at a dollar. Nothing to convert. Nothing to decode.
Which means the price is already a probability. 62 cents is 62%. Bookie Brian writes the same idea as −163 and leaves you to dig it back out.
Nobody here writes the price
This is the part that catches people. Brian is still in the room. He is just not setting the number any more.
What he runs is a list. Everyone willing to buy, everyone willing to sell, and how many contracts each of them wants. That list is the order book, and the list is the price. He charges a fee for keeping the room open. He is not on either side, so he does not care who wins.
Joe hates this. He wants one number, posted, so he can bet it. There is no one number. There are two, and a gap between them.
The middle of the gap is the lazy answer
Buyers are stacked up at 61 cents, 400 contracts deep. Sellers are at 63 cents, and there are only 100 of them. Split the difference and you get 62. That is the midpoint, and it is the number almost every screenshot quotes.
The two sides are not the same size though. One is a wall and one is a screen door. Weight the price by how much is standing on each side and it comes out at 62.6, leaning at the thin side, because the thin side is the one about to go. That weighted number has a name. It is the microprice.

A sportsbook sells you a price it wrote. An exchange shows you what other people are willing to do, and charges you to join in. Those are different products that happen to look alike.
What it costs you
Two costs, and you can work out both before you click. The first is the spread you cross: on a 61 cent bid and a 63 cent ask, buying right now costs a cent over the midpoint. The second is the fee, which Kalshi publishes.
peaks at a coin flip, so the fee tops out at 1.75¢ per contract at 50¢ and falls toward the tails. That is the exact inverse of sportsbook vig, which lands heaviest on longshots. Because the fee is charged per trade and settlement is free, a round trip pays it twice while holding to resolution pays it once.

What is settled, and what is not
Settled. Kalshi is a designated contract market regulated by the CFTC under the Commodity Exchange Act. Its contracts are financial instruments on a federally regulated exchange, not wagers taken by a licensed gaming operator. That is a genuinely different legal category from a sportsbook, and it is why an account there opens under securities-style identity rules rather than a state gaming licence.
Not settled, and we are not going to pretend otherwise:
- State gaming law. Several state regulators say sports event contracts are wagering under their statutes, and have ordered exchanges to stop. The exchanges fought back in federal court, arguing that federal commodities law preempts state gaming law. Different circuits have gone different ways, and it was live litigation when this page was reviewed.
- Where you may trade. Each venue sets its own availability, it moves with each ruling, and it does not match the map of states where sports betting is legal. The venue’s own terms are the only current answer.
- Tax. Event contract proceeds are not obviously gambling winnings, and the form a venue sends may not be the W-2G a sportsbook would. Practitioners disagree. Ask a tax professional about your own situation.
Content farms in this niche state all three as though they were resolved. They are not. This page is information about market mechanics, not legal or tax advice, and none of it suggests you open an account or take any position.

An order book, not a posted line
The structural difference from a sportsbook is who is on the other side of you. A book is your counterparty: it writes the price, holds the opposite position, and pads both sides so it profits on balanced action. An exchange holds no position ever. It publishes two stacks of resting orders, bids (what buyers will pay) and asks (what sellers will take), matches a YES against a NO, and charges a fee either way.
Two roles fall out of that. A maker rests an order and waits to be filled. A taker crosses the book and trades now, at the posted price. The taker pays for immediacy; the maker gets paid for supplying it. There is no equivalent choice at a sportsbook, where every bet is a take.
Three consequences worth spelling out:
- The cost is explicit. A book’s margin is hidden inside the price. An exchange charges a stated fee and shows you the spread you are crossing. Both are costs; only one is itemised.
- Depth is visible. A posted line tells you nothing about how much money stands behind it. An order book tells you exactly how many contracts sit at each price, and therefore how far your own order will move it.
- Winning accounts aren’t a liability. A book’s profit depends on you losing, which is why books limit or ban consistent winners. An exchange earns the same fee whichever side wins.

Why the price is the probability
The body says 62 cents is 62%. That is an identity, not a slogan, and here is where it comes from.
A contract has exactly two payoffs. There is nothing in between:
Call the event’s real chance . The expected payoff is what the contract returns on average, which is one line of arithmetic:
So the average payoff is the probability, in dollars. A price below returns more than it costs on average and gets bought. A price above it gets sold. The number the crowd stops at is their estimate of , wearing a dollar sign.
One honest caveat. That derivation assumes a trader who cares only about the average and not about the risk itself. Real people care about both, which is one reason the tails lean. There is a section on that further down.
The second identity is the one a sportsbook price cannot manage. A single exchange price sums to 100% by construction: YES at 62 cents and NO at 38 cents are the same claim read from opposite ends. A book’s two prices sum past 100%, and you have to de-vig them before either one means anything.
An exchange has an overround too. It is just the spread
One price sums to 100%. A two-sided quote does not, and the amount it overshoots by is not a coincidence.
Take the book in the figure above: 61 bid, 63 ask on Chalk. Buying YES right now costs 63 cents. Buying NO right now costs whatever NO is asking, and NO’s ask is the mirror of the YES bid:
Buy both sides and you pay 63 + 39 = 102 cents for a pair that is certain to return exactly $1, because one of them settles at a dollar and the other at zero. Two cents over, on a two-cent spread. Those are always the same number:
An exchange’s two-way margin is its spread, to the cent, before fees. A sportsbook has the same overshoot and calls it the vig, but it is welded into the two prices and you have to do arithmetic to find it. Here it is the gap you can already see on the screen.

Where the 64.2 cent fill came from
An order for 400 contracts cannot all fill at 63 cents, because only 100 are offered there. It eats the stack a level at a time and pays more at each one:
The posted ask said 63. The order paid 64.2. That gap is slippage, and it is why a top-of-book quote is not a price for any size you feel like. Afterwards the best remaining ask is 66 against a 61 bid, so the quoted midpoint jumps to 63.5 without anybody changing their mind. Depth moved it, not news.
The venues, and how they differ
“Prediction market” covers three quite different machines. Status below is a snapshot dated 24 July 2026; access rules and fee schedules are set by the venues and change without notice.
| Venue | Structure | Settles by | US access |
|---|---|---|---|
| Kalshi | Central limit order book, US dollars, CFTC-regulated designated contract market | Exchange, against the contract’s written rulebook | Open to US users; contested by some state regulators |
| Polymarket | Central limit order book on-chain, USDC collateral | UMA optimistic oracle: proposal, challenge window, token-holder vote | Historically restricted for US persons; status has moved, so verify |
| Betfair Exchange | Back/lay exchange in decimal odds, commission on net market winnings | Exchange, against published market rules | Not available to US users |
Betfair is worth one extra sentence because its quoting convention hides the same object. “Backing at 2.50” and “buying at 40¢” are the same trade: decimal odds invert to an implied probability, and that probability is the contract price.

What a price is not
A prediction-market price is an estimate produced by whoever showed up, weighted by how much money they brought. It is often a very good estimate. It is not an oracle, and two failure modes are measurable.
The tails lean. A 2026 study of more than 300,000 settled Kalshi contracts found prices informative and sharpening toward close, and low-priced contracts winning less often than the fee-adjusted break-even required.[2] That is the favorite–longshot bias, first measured at racetracks in 1949[3] and found in essentially every betting pool since.[4] Our fair-line machinery shades longshots down for exactly this reason; treating an exchange as unbiased is a modelling error with a price tag.
Quiet books lie. A tight-looking spread on a market nobody has touched in three hours is decoration. Postponed games are the sharpest version: the market stays open, the resting orders go stale, and the quote becomes a fossil that still renders like a live price. Every number on this site carries both timestamps (when we computed it and when the venue last moved it) because staleness is the failure no screenshot reveals.

Frequently asked questions
What is a prediction market?
A prediction market is an exchange where people trade binary event contracts. Each contract pays $1 if a stated event happens and $0 if it does not, so its trading price in cents is the market's implied probability of that event. The exchange matches buyers against sellers and never takes a position.
What is an event contract?
An event contract is a claim on a stated, verifiable outcome that settles at $1 if the outcome occurs and $0 if it does not. Buying YES at 62¢ costs $0.62 per contract and returns $1.00 if the event resolves YES. Buying NO at 38¢ is the same trade from the other side.
How is a prediction market different from a sportsbook?
A sportsbook posts a price, takes the other side of your bet, and pads both sides so the implied probabilities sum above 100%. A prediction market runs an order book: your counterparty is another trader, the venue charges an explicit fee instead of an overround, and your cost is the spread you cross plus that fee.
Who regulates prediction markets in the United States?
Kalshi operates as a CFTC-regulated designated contract market, so its event contracts sit under federal commodities law rather than state gaming law. Whether sports event contracts also fall under individual states' gaming statutes has been contested in court and is unsettled. This page is information, not legal advice.
Does a contract price tell you the true probability?
It is an estimate, not an oracle. Research on 300,000+ settled Kalshi contracts found prices informative and sharpening toward close, yet low-priced longshot contracts won less often than the fee-adjusted break-even required. Treat a price as one estimate among several, and shade the tails.
